Frequently Asked Questions about Cobbs Hill

What type of rentals are currently available in Cobbs Hill?

There are currently 61 Apartments for Rent in Cobbs Hill, NY with pricing that ranges from $925 to $3,250. There are also 9 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Cobbs Hill ranging from $1,750 to $2,995.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Cobbs Hill?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Cobbs Hill ranges from $1,750 to $2,995 with an average monthly rent of $2,262.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Cobbs Hill?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Cobbs Hill range from $1,750 to $1,900,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,800 to $2,600.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,400 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,400.
